Is 129 273 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 129 273 is about 359.546.

Thus, the square root of 129 273 is not an integer, and therefore 129 273 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 129 273?

The square of a number (here 129 273) is the result of the product of this number (129 273) by itself (i.e., 129 273 × 129 273); the square of 129 273 is sometimes called "raising 129 273 to the power 2", or "129 273 squared".

The square of 129 273 is 16 711 508 529 because 129 273 × 129 273 = 129 2732 = 16 711 508 529.

As a consequence, 129 273 is the square root of 16 711 508 529.
